摘要

This paper presents two Q-band bandpass filter designs that are targeted for application in the Atacama Large Millimeter-wave and Submillimeter-wave Array (ALMA) radio telescope. The bandpass filter is required to reject the lower side band from 15.2∼29GHz and retain minimum loss across the passband of 31.3∼45GHz. The bandpass filter based on WR22 waveguide is first presented. Specifically, the measured in-band insertion loss is around 0.4 dB, and the rejection of lower sideband is better than 34dB. To further reduce the circuit size and to ease the integration with other MMICs in the receiver, a planar filter design based on GaAs process is also demonstrated. It will be applied to the multi-chip module version of the heterodyne receiver design to achieve more compact module size.
